Young athlete health screening

Terviseuuringud.ee participates in a prevention project funded by the Estonian Health Insurance Fund, “Young Athletes’ Health Screening for the Prevention of Sports-Related Health Risks.”

Health examinations for young athletes who belong to the target group are funded from the Health Insurance Fund’s healthcare insurance budget, and the patient is only required to pay a 5 € visit fee.

We accept young athletes up to 19 years of age (inclusive) for the young athletes’ health screening, provided they train and compete regularly for at least 6 academic hours per week in addition to physical education classes
(one academic hour = 45 minutes).

Young athletes who train and compete less than six academic hours per week are monitored by their family physicians as part of routine health check-ups.

Physician appointments take place in Tallinn, Sepapaja 12/1, 4th floor, Ülemiste City district (Health Building 2).

Target group

The young athletes’ health screening is intended for young people up to 19 years of age (inclusive) who, in addition to physical education classes, train and compete regularly for at least 6 academic hours per week
(one academic hour = 45 minutes).

Young athletes who train and compete less than six academic hours per week are monitored by family physicians as part of routine health check-ups.

The scope, content, and frequency of the health examination depend on the young athlete’s weekly training load, health status, and the results of the primary examinations.

Based on the examination results, the physician issues a decision granting permission to participate in sports or, if health problems are identified, sets restrictions on sports participation.

Health examination packages for young athletes

As part of the Health Insurance Fund’s prevention project, three different health examination complexes have been developed for young athletes. Which complex (A, B, or C) is performed as the initial examination depends on the young athlete’s training load, the nature of the sport, health status, and the results of the primary examinations.
